Vissla's "Island South"

October 19, 2016

Vissla recently took their new wetsuits to New Zealand and had Bryce Young, Brendon Gibbens and Eric Geiselman ramp out in the frosty Kiwi waters of the South Island in them.

The trip began as simply an idea in their minds. The three of them had been scoring some epic el Niño swells at home, but they came at the high price of social media spot blowouts, crowds, and angry girlfriends. Eric, Bryce, and Brendon needed to get out and away and decided to spin a globe, looked at the charts and dialed in their location.

Watch the boys get down in the cold and completely remote location where they surfed with seals that looked like lions and were greeted on the beach by penguins.
